The Sarenne power plant: green energy production and biodiversity preservation

This structure participates fully in CNR’s strategy to develop hydroelectricity activities elsewhere than the Rhone and represents for Isère a new green energy production asset for accelerating the territory’s energy transition. It stretches over 3 municipalities in Isère:

  • Huez (alt.1,456 m) where the water intake is located,
  • La Garde-en-Oisans, crossed by the railway, completely underground along 3,660 m,
  • Le Bourg d’Oisans (alt.721 m) where the hydropower plant is located.

The development has been designed to maintain constant balance between economic exploitation, respect for biodiversity, and taking into account a sensitive mountain environment.

The water intake

Located at Huez at an altitude of 1,456 m, it includes:

  • an intake weir equipped with a fine trash rack to take the discharge for the turbine and also allow the downstream passage of fish;
  • a sand trap to decant abrasive materials from the torrent before it enters the penstocks;
  • a sand trap scour gate to ensure sediment transport;
  • a fish pass with 12 successive basins to ensure fish continuity and the transit of 120 l/s of compensation water.

The water conduit

The water conduit measures 3,660 m in length. It is completely underground or buried in order to preserve the mountain landscape of Oisans. It is composed of several sections between the water intake and the turbines: 

  • a main gallery 4.20 m in diameter excavated by a tunnel boring machine that bored through the hard rock of the Oisans massif along 2.3 km on a very steep slope of 22%, then equipped with penstocks with a diameter of 900 mm.
  • 380 m of penstocks buried under 80 cm and resting on a sand bed;
  • a well tilted at 45° constructed using the raise-boring technique, with a diameter of 1.8 m along 350 m, into which the penstock of 800 mm in diameter has been inserted;
  • an existing horizontal gallery 500 m long, dating from the beginning of the 1980s, equipped with a penstock with a diameter of 800 mm, arriving at the power plant.

The excavation spoils were treated in the perimeter of the project and deposited a few metres from the place of extraction on a deposit slope arranged for this purpose and planted with local plants.

The hydropower plant of Bourg d’Oisans

Located at Bourg d’Oisans at an altitude of 721 m, it is composed of two buildings:

  • the main building housing the two Pelton turbines of 5.5 MW each, a room grouping the automated controls, and a control and instrumentation room;
  • the switchyard enclosing the two transformers and high voltage stations.

All the structures are controlled remotely with regular visits made to all the equipment.

The works were carried out from March 2021 to September 2024, for €50 M (value in 2025).

The design and supervision of the works was entrusted to BG Ingénieurs Conseils (merged with WSP in 2024).
